Abstract in another language
Although it is highly desirable to detect directly hydrocarbons in exhaust gases for future on-board-diagnostics, conventional zirconia lambda probes monitor only the oxygen activity, due to their catalytically active electrodes. HC-sensor based on SrTiO3 thick films are less catalytic active and are able to detect HC down to 10ppm. Both sensor types are tested in laboratory exhaust gases with converters. Implications for catalyst monitoring are investigated.
